((Waaay back in the 20s bracket the Dreamspeakers formed a channel called pvp29. Since then we've had one for each level bracket, and have managed to cobble together a rough PvP team that has survived into our 50s. A few nights a week we gather between 8-12 people into a raid and do Arathi Basin together.

Amato and Lhuurssa have both been a part of those raids, and I see other familiar faces here as well. Now that we have a new home we'd like to extend an invitation to anyone in the 50s to join us =)

Our 'team' is nothing official or overly organized. Just a group of friends who go into AB to have fun. We work together and use various strategies, but we are not demanding of those who join us. Many have only recently tried PvP for the first time while others are very experienced.

We haven't used teamspeak to date, but when we reach 60 are considering making things more organized and doing so. So, if anyone is interested in checking us out feel free to join pvp59 or just look me up in guild chat))

((What makes Arathi Basin and Alterac Valley far more fun for me than Warsong Gulch is that because the scope of the games are larger you have more time to get in bits of RP during the match. One of the things that I love about the people in the current 50-59 bracket is that most of us also like to RP.

We'll spend time after tense battles speaking in hushed whispers about how the spectre of death passed us by, and there are quite a few "For the Horde!" or other rallying cries in each match.

When we were a part of Vigilance on the Alliance side we did several RP/PvP events outside of the battlegrounds which were also very fun. The largest was called the Battle of Silverpine. A score of alliance took the field against half that many horde when they heard that the horde were planning an attack on Tyrande herself.

The fight itself was fun, but what made the event fun was definitely the RP as the alliance rode through a dark corrupted forest without any clear idea of what they'd be facing when they finally found their horde adversaries.))
